ISE course: Graduate Recruitment 101

 

Description

Getting to grips with the graduate recruitment industry isn't the easiest of tasks. There are a number of elements to consider like where to start with research, what are the market trends, how to get access to the best talent in the market and develop a recruitment process. With that in mind, we have the essential one-stop course for all graduate recruiters who are new to the industry.

 

Course Structure - Benefits of attending

  • Give an overview of the current UK graduate jobs and education markets
  • Find and access relevant market research
  • Develop a basic brand and attraction / marketing plan, including how to work with Universities
  • Plan a standard graduate recruitment process
  • Run a simple tendering process for out-sourced activities
  • Identify and use relevant measures and metrics to prove return on investment

 

Who should attend?

Generally aimed at junior levels and perhaps intermediate levels. Senior levels, especially those that are double hatting as a talent manager/HRBP in a small to medium size firm may also get value out of this course.

Course Leader

Rebecca Fielding of Gradconsult and an ISE associate

Rebecca Fielding recruited and developed thousands of people, whilst in senior roles at Aon, the Co-operative Group, HJ Heinz and Asda. Formerly a Director of the ISE for six years, Rebecca has also worked in a University, won national awards for her work, judged various industry awards and sat on a wide variety of sector advisory bodies. Since founding her business in 2012 Rebecca has worked with hundreds of employers, of all sectors and sizes and over 60% of the UK’s Universities. Now working with an increasingly European and global client base, an international conference speaker, ISE Fellow and regular commentator in the press on the graduate market, Rebecca is a highly regarded and expert member of the ISE community.
